Abstract:One of merits for high fidelity vibroseis acquisition is to gain single vibrator records by separating arithmetically stacking data of multi-vibrators and multi-sweeps.The method reduces source array effect and improves the data accuracy.But in vibroseis acquisition,a single vibrator as a source is seldom adopted due to its energy limit.To extend the applicable range of high fidelity vibroseis acquisition,the energy of high fidelity vibroseis should be analyzed and the applicable condition and working area should be studied.By testing different number of vibrators and different sweeps and analyzing field data,the relationship between energy and the number of vibrators and sweeps is found.Our experiments show that the maximum energy of a single vibrator should meet geological requirements for high fidelity vibroseis acquisition.
